The garage occupancy feed for the Brindlewood campus arrives over a message queue every thirty seconds, one record per level, published by the Stallgrid edge boxes. Counts can briefly go negative when a sensor double-fires on exit; the ingest job clamps these to zero and flags the interval. If the feed stalls for more than five minutes, the dashboard falls back to the last known snapshot. Sensor mappings, queue names, and the replay procedure are documented on the internal page below.

runbook for tahog-kadug: https://gitlab.qirvanworks.corp/projects/pages/view/b139298aed28

## Break-Glass: Per-Tenant Rate Quotas

Hey reviewer — quick context before you approve. Quotas on Fenwick Gate are enforced per tenant in the edge layer, and normally nobody can raise them without a change ticket. Break-glass exists for the rare case where a tenant is hard-locked out during an incident. Using it bypasses the approval bot, logs loudly, and pages the quota owners. The override console only opens after you enter the recovery passphrase below.

vault phrase of bagaf-kajeg = jorath-feniel-briir-siliel-ralix

## Service Accounts for Quillhaven Schema Registry

Every service that publishes or consumes events must register schemas through Quillhaven using a dedicated service account, never a personal login. Each account is scoped to a single namespace and granted either read or read-write access, which keeps audit trails clean and limits blast radius. As a contractor, you'll use the shared sandbox account for all exploratory work. The sandbox account authenticates with the key shown below.

gateway credential: vxb4-QTMv

**PedalShift rebalancer — runbook fragment**

The PedalShift rebalancing tool computes dock transfer plans every 20 minutes from telemetry in the Copperline feed. If plans stop updating, restart the planner pod and confirm the feed offset resets. Stale plans older than an hour are discarded automatically. When filing an incident, record the planner's current build token, which appears below.

build token for kagaf-hahof: htk14_9d3d4d26d7d8de